  1. “Have found… an exit,” she says.
  2.  
  3. Kamran thinks back to all of the drawings he’s seen of the Javaher Concourse, and the entire point of the place is that there’s only one way in or out. That’s part of the reason he feels safe here—or did until recently.
  4.  
  5. “Air movement,” Marsalis taps out the words to her overdriven speaker. “Path open somewhere.”
  6.  
  7. “Open, like…” Becker starts.
  8.  
  9. Lips snarl in time with the words, though no sounds follow. “If I can find it… children can find it.”
  10.  
  11. Kamran has to blunt the needle of panic forming inside him. This castle isn’t nearly as impregnable as he’d led himself to believe. He never should’ve survived being in the same room with the monsters the first time. He doubts he’ll survive another encounter.
  12.  
  13. “As a rule, we assume that the x-rays can get into any place they can fit their heads,” Becker says. “If Marsalis says there’s an opening, then this place is compromised.”
  14.  
  15. Kamran looks over Marsalis’s form: sleekness interrupted by spikes and ridges. It’s hard to imagine them folding inward to pass through a tight fit, but perhaps the creature bends in unpredictable ways. Perhaps all of them do.
  16.  
  17. ***
  18.  
  19. Alien: Into Charybdis, Chapter 27
